Valentine's Day, often hailed as the day of love and romance, can be a challenging time for those who are not currently in a relationship. While the holiday is typically associated with couples exchanging gifts, heartfelt gestures, and romantic dinners, being single on Valentine's Day doesn't mean you can't have a great time. In this article, we'll delve into some exciting ways to celebrate Valentine's Day, even if you're not in a relationship.

Embrace Self-Love

Valentine's Day can be the perfect occasion to pamper yourself. Treat yourself to a spa day, buy that item you've had your eye on, or indulge in your favorite meal. Remember, self-love is just as important as romantic love.

Celebrate with Friends

Gather your single friends and have a fun night out. Whether it's a movie marathon, a game night, or a themed party, spending time with friends can make Valentine's Day memorable and enjoyable.

Spread Love to Others

Consider performing acts of kindness, such as volunteering at a local charity or sending thoughtful messages to loved ones. Sharing love and positivity can make you feel more connected to the spirit of the day.

Focus on Hobbies and Interests

Use this day to engage in activities you're passionate about. Whether it's painting, cooking, or taking a solo adventure, pursuing your interests can be fulfilling and distracting.

No matter your relationship status, Valentine's Day can be a day of joy and self-discovery. Embrace the love you have for yourself and the people around you, and make the most of this special day. Celebrate your single life in style!
